Successful tester

  Software Tester must  possess the below guidelines  t o be successful, • Concise:  As simple as possible and no simpler. • Self-Checking:  Test reports its own results; needs no human interpretation. • Repeatable:  Test can be run many times in a row without human intervention. • Robust and logical:  Test produces same result now and forever. Tests are not affected by changes in the external environment.  • Sufficient:  Tests verify all the requirements of the software being tested. • Necessary:  Everything in each test contributes to the specification of desired behavior. • Clear:  Every statement is easy to understand. • Efficient:  Tests run in a reasonable amount of time. • Specific:  Each test failure points to a specific piece of broken functionality; unit test failures provide "defect triangulation". • Independent:  Each test can be run by itself or in a suite with an arbitrary set of other tests in any order...
